Why Baby Is Refusing To Take Bottle Milk For The Whole Day?

My 5 month old baby refuse to take the bottle yesterday. She had 4 oz of milk in the morning and then didn't want to drink at all during the rest of the day. She is happy and smiling when we took the bottle away from her. We finally had to hand feed her using a medicine syringe at night and got 3.5 oz around 8:30 last night. We thought she is teething and got her oral gel. That didn't seem to work either. What could be the cause?

4oz is approximately 120 ml. The capacity of infant stomach is 10 ml per kilogramme of body weight. Feeding her 4 oz is too much a time.
I would suggest you to feed less quantity and feed more frequently.
Let the feeds be on demand. Stop when the child is not taking further, and feed anytime the child demands for it
